Concrete patching services involve repairing damaged or deteriorated sections of concrete surfaces to restore their strength, appearance, and safety. This process typically includes cleaning the area, removing loose or crumbling concrete, and applying a specially formulated patching material to fill cracks, holes, or spalled areas. The goal is to create a smooth, durable surface that can withstand daily use and environmental conditions. Professional contractors use various techniques and materials to ensure the patched area blends seamlessly with the surrounding concrete, helping to extend the lifespan of the surface.
Many common problems can be addressed with concrete patching. Cracks and holes often develop over time due to settling, temperature fluctuations, or heavy use. These issues can compromise the integrity of driveways, walkways, patios, or garage floors, leading to tripping hazards or further damage if left untreated. Patching can also repair surface spalling-where the concrete begins to break apart or flake-and fill in areas where previous repairs have failed. Proper patching not only improves the look of a property but also helps prevent water infiltration and structural de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Patching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aurora,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or patching jobs in Aurora, IL often range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and extent of the damage.
Moderate Projects - Larger patches or repairs that cover a significant area generally c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for residential driveways and walkways needing more extensive work.
Large or Complex Repairs - For more involved patching work, such as repairing multiple sections or dealing with structural issues, costs can range from $1,500-$3,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they are necessary for substantial repairs.
Full Replacement - Complete concrete replacement projects in the Aurora area can exceed $5,000+, especially for large commercial or multi-area jobs. These are less frequent but are essential for severely damaged or deteriorated concrete surfaces.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of cracks can concrete patching services repair? Local contractors can fix various cracks, including surface cracks, structural cracks, and hairline fractures, to restore the integrity of concrete surfaces.
Is concrete patching suitable for both indoor and outdoor surfaces? Yes, service providers can handle patching for both indoor flooring and outdoor structures like driveways, sidewalks, and patios.
What materials are commonly used in concrete patching? Contractors typically use cement-based mixes, epoxy compounds, or polymer-modified mortars depending on the repair needs and surface conditions.
Can concrete patching help prevent further damage? Proper patching by experienced local contractors can reinforce the surface and reduce the risk of additional cracking or deterioration.
What signs indicate that concrete patching services are needed? Visible cracks, spalling, uneven surfaces, or exposed aggregate are common indicators that patching may be necessary to maintain the surface’s condition.
